A Kentucky man fell 1,500 feet to his death in the Union Township area when his parachute failed to open Aug. 22.

Thomas J. Bartlett, 21, of Owensboro, Ky., jumped from a helicopter around 7:30 p.m. last Friday night near the Rowe Woods, which is part of the Cincinnati Nature Center.

Union Township police sergeant Scott Gaviglia said that Bartlett’s parachute opened only 10 to 40 feet from the ground of a resident’s back yard, just due east of the nature center and Tealtown Road, which was tragically too late, Gaviglia said.

Bartlett, who was pronounced dead after arriving at the Anderson Mercy Hospital, was an experienced sky diver who took care of his own equipment, Gaviglia said.
